The Basics of Wild Local Citation
Wild local citation involves the mention of a business’s name, address, and phone number (NAP) on various online platforms, such as directories, review sites, and social media. Unlike traditional local citations that focus on well-known directories like Yelp or Google My Business, wild local citations encompass a broader array of sources, including niche directories and community websites.
Key Benefits of Wild Local Citation
- Enhances Local SEO: By diversifying your citation profile across a wide range of platforms, you can improve your local search rankings and make it easier for potential customers to find you.
- Builds Trust and Credibility: Having consistent NAP information across multiple sites establishes trust with both search engines and consumers, enhancing your brand’s credibility.
- Increases Online Visibility: Wild local citations expose your business to new audiences and niches, expanding your online visibility beyond the usual channels.
